description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Acts upstream of or within bone development and negative regulation of bone trabecula formation. Predicted to be located in extracellular region. Predicted to be active in extracellular matrix and extracellular space. Is expressed in several structures, including cartilage; sensory organ; skeleton; trachea cartilaginous ring; and ventral body wall. Orthologous to human CHAD (chondroadherin).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a knock-out allele exhibit widened epiphyseal growth plate, abnormal tracbecular and cortical bone morphology and lower femoral neck failure load and tibial strength.
